These engineering marvels consist of three key components: a robust workbench, a finely-tuned mold, and a cutting-edge power system. The workbench offers steadfast support and impeccable stability, anchoring the metal sheets securely in place, while the precision-engineered mold expertly guides each bend with meticulous accuracy. At the core of this magnificent machinery, the advanced power system acts as the driving force, meticulously orchestrating pressure and motion controls to ensure flawless and consistent bends. Back-gauge
Setting new industry standards, the CNHAWE back-gauge system exemplifies precision and excellence, establishing itself as the benchmark in the press brake sector.
Our steadfast commitment to precision is evident in the use of imported ball screws and linear guides. These premium components enhance the accuracy and consistency of CNHAWE's CNC series press brakes, pushing production excellence to unprecedented heights.
Our back-gauge frame is subjected to a meticulous high-temperature tempering process to alleviate internal stress, enhancing metal plasticity and toughness. This crucial step ensures precision is maintained by preventing frame deformation, guaranteeing lasting reliability.

Crowning System
CNHAWE pioneers the forefront of press brake crowning compensation systems, driven by relentless innovation and production excellence. Our electric lower and comprehensive hydraulic clamping systems accurately compute compensation values, ensuring impeccable alignment of deformation and compensation curves for perfect straightness and angle consistency.
